Output 255e59db7c0b906bdea5c1e8aa30fcdb7451a6ce2e8e4ba03b95af44b7e7e270:192

value
672536
script pubkey
OP_0 OP_PUSHBYTES_20 e2951e8ee901cbef2611e75bd7e0786f53d44c40
address
bc1qu223arhfq8977fs3uada0crcdafagnzqmfc02q
transaction
255e59db7c0b906bdea5c1e8aa30fcdb7451a6ce2e8e4ba03b95af44b7e7e270
spent
true